摘要
We design, implement, and compare several parallel version codes of our shelterbelt turbulent flow model system which involves extremely strong non-linear processes, solid-air interactions, flow-pressure linkages, and turbulent feedback mechanisms. We evaluate the performance of each implementation and show that the parallel code's performance depends ors its design and coding strategies. The performance gains of the domain decomposition parallel version of our model system are quite satisfactory. For functional decomposition, we even obtained parallel performance loss. We analyze the speedup and its change with domain size and number of processors. There is tradeoff between reduced computation load and increased communication load, and the relative weight, which is related to domain size, number of processors, and problem specific features, determines the speed ratio and load balance ratio.
